What we test for

The failure modes that matter

Prompt injection

Crafted inputs that override your system's instructions — through user messages, retrieved documents, or tool outputs.

Jailbreaks & guardrail bypass

Techniques that talk a model out of its safety and policy constraints, making it say or do what it was configured to refuse.

Data leakage

System prompts, other users' data, or internal context extracted through the model's own answers.

Excessive agency

Agents with tools — email, databases, payments — manipulated into taking actions no one intended to authorise.

How an engagement runs

Scope, test, harden

  1. 01

    Scope

    We map your AI surface — models, prompts, retrieval sources, tools, and the data each can reach — and agree what's in bounds.

  2. 02

    Test

    Structured adversarial testing against the agreed scope: injection, jailbreak, and leakage attempts documented with reproduction steps.

  3. 03

    Report & harden

    Findings ranked by real-world impact, each with a concrete fix — then we help implement the fixes and retest.
